Output 23b6f0df65a24942a2e5f182fce218677e504a6779185908fc0e2388a45dabfd:2

value
196087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c1ce412ffc415177588e4a29856da16ce66697 OP_EQUAL
address
3MT83qKp2uPXknjzNzmyhqajSjPUb13QLA
transaction
23b6f0df65a24942a2e5f182fce218677e504a6779185908fc0e2388a45dabfd
confirmations
206156
spent
true